26-year-old man was struck by gunfire at least five times, police say
SAN ANTONIO – A man was shot multiple times while sitting in a vehicle on the North Side, San Antonio police said Wednesday.
Officers responded to the shooting around 9:15 p.m. in the 1800 block of East Sonterra Boulevard, near the U.S. Highway 281 access road.
According to police, an unknown number of people pulled up in a vehicle next to the man and fired at least 12 shots before the vehicle sped off.
The victim, a 26-year-old man, was hit at least five times, police said. His condition is unclear.
Police are investigating if the shooting was targeted.
Additional information was not immediately available.
